J. Mourinho criticized his youth and club management after unsuccessful matches

Jose Mourinho after yet another unsuccessful preparation match did not hold back and said everything he thinks about the prospects of the "Manchester United" team players.

The "Red Devils", who are still forced to play without key players, suffered a defeat against "Liverpool" during the preparation. Jurgen Klopp's players dominated the match and crushed the opponents with a score of 4-1.

After the match, J. Mourinho stated that no one should expect better results with this squad, and the brightest star of the team, Alexis Sanchez, is just "a soldier on the field".

A journalist asked the Portuguese why A. Sanchez looks so unhappy - J. Mourinho couldn't hold back: "Look, do you want him to be happy playing with the players we have now?"

"In this preparation cycle, the most important thing is to somehow get through it and not experience even more embarrassing defeats. Alexis is the only attacker we have. He is a poor man trying to squeeze the best out of this situation," continued the Portuguese.

Later, J. Mourinho pointed out that these results should not be taken too seriously, as the vast majority of the current players will not start in the main team when the season begins.

"We started the match with most players who will not be there when the season begins. This is not the squad I will work with. Not even half of the players will be there on August 9th. So, you should not read too much into it," J. Mourinho continued to show his lack of confidence in his youth.

After the match, J. Mourinho did not hesitate to criticize the club's management, saying that they are not working in the transfer window as they should.

"I would like to get two more new players, but I think I won't get them. It's possible I will get one player. But he will be one of those five I mentioned to the club a few months ago," J. Mourinho concluded.
